Energy Efficiency

By replacing your single-pane windows with modern double-glazed windows, you will improve the energy efficiency of your home while saving money on your utility bills. Double-glazed windows provide superior insulation and can stop your home from losing heat in winter and gaining it back in summer. This means that you do not need to spend as much on cooling or heating.

Double-glazed windows also come with seals to keep out dust and pollution. This helps you to maintain your home in a pleasant environment while minimizing the negative impacts of Melbourne's climate on your home. The insulation also helps keep out cold winter air and hot weather in summer.

A double-glazed window is a unit of two insulated glass panes that are hermetically sealed together with spacers and other elements. They create pockets between the two panes of glass which acts as an insulation. The air inside this pocket may be filled with a variety gases like krypton or the argon.

These windows are more efficient in reducing heat losses than standard single-pane aluminum-framed windows. Double-paned windows are also called Insulated glass units. They consist of two glass panes that are separated by an inert gas such as nitrogen, krypton, or argon to increase energy efficiency. They are more energy efficient than single-paned windows. They also reduce heating and cooling costs, reduce condensation and outside noise pollution. They are also more durable and secure, as it's difficult to break through three thick layers of glass. The extra layer of glass is more expensive than single-pane windows, but the savings you'll see on your energy bill will offset the initial cost.
